WebJan 6, 2024 · Insurance underwriting is the way an insurance company assesses the risk and profitability of offering a policy to someone. An insurance company must have a way to decide just how much of a gamble it's taking by providing coverage. It also needs to know the chances that something will go wrong, causing it to have to pay out a claim. WebSep 25, 2024 · During the underwriting process, the underwriter examines the applicant’s medical history, demographics, prior claims, and lifestyle choices. It tries to determine the risk the insurer will face in insuring the person applying for a health insurance policy. Medical underwriting refers to insurance companies using an applicant's medical history to determine whether they're eligible for coverage, and if so, whether to include a pre-existing condition exclusion and/or higher premium. WebUnderwriting is the process that life insurance companies use to assess risk. During underwriting, the life insurance company will review your medical records and decide whether to provide coverage. If you are approved for coverage, the life insurance company will set your premiums based on the level of risk they have determined you pose.
